  2. 8 de ago. de 2019 · All Fish Are Equipped With Gills. LuismiX/Getty Images. Like all animals, fish need oxygen in order to fuel their metabolism: the difference is that terrestrial vertebrates breathe air, while fish rely on oxygen dissolved in water. To this end, fish have evolved gills, complex, efficient, multi-layered organs that absorb oxygen from the water ...

  6. Fish and shellfish. A healthy, balanced diet should include at least 2 portions of fish a week, including 1 of oily fish. That's because fish and shellfish are good sources of many vitamins and minerals. Oily fish – such as salmon and sardines – is also particularly high in long-chain omega-3 fatty acids, which can help to keep your heart ...
